Instructions

  1. Wash hands with soap and water.
  2. Cook celery, green pepper, and onion in vegetable oil in a large saucepan until soft, about 5 minutes.
  3. Break up large pieces of tomatoes. Add tomatoes and seasonings to vegetable mixture.
  4. Bring to a boil. Add beans and return to a boil.
  5. Cover and cook over low heat until flavors are blended and liquid is cooked away, about 30 minutes. Stir once and a while to prevent sticking.
